It was the settlement Luke Sayers’ friends and advisers were waiting for. On Friday, 19 months after a lewd photo posted to X blew up his life, the former boss of PwC and president of Carlton Football Club publicly apologised to his ex-wife, Cate, for suggesting she was the poster.

Not that he was there to apologise in person. He was in Italy.
